SonarQube 6.4覆盖NUnit 3

时间:2017-06-19 10:20:11

标签: c# sonarqube nunit-3.0

我有一个配置SonarQube 6.4 +声纳扫描仪和带有Attlasian Bamboo的NUnit 3和许多C#项目。

我希望使用NUnit在SonarQube上进行配置覆盖。如何在服务器上的全局参数中进行,而不是在项目级别进行?

1 个答案:

答案 0 :(得分:1)

MSBuild.SonarQube.Runner.exe begin / n:“UFO-Auth master”/ k:“UFO-Auth:master”/ v:“93”/s:"C:\sonarqube-6.4\sonarqube-6.4 \ sonar-scanner-msbuild-3.0.0.629 \ bin \ SonarQube.Analysis.xml“/d:sonar.cs.nunit.reportsPaths="%CD%\NUnitResults.xml”/d:sonar.cs.opencover.reportsPaths= “%CD%\ opencover.xml”

CD我的文件夹 MSBuild.exe / t:重建

“C:\ Users \ ufo_bamboo_agent \ AppData \ Local \ Apps \ OpenCover \ OpenCover.Console.exe”-output:“%CD%\ opencover.xml”-register:user -target:“C:\ Program Files (x86)\ NUnit.org \ nunit-console \ nunit3-console.exe“-targetdir:”C:\ bamboo_agent \ xml-data \ build-dir \ UFO-UFAUT-JOB1 \ Auth \ RGS.UFO.Auth.Tests \ bin \ Debug“-targetargs:”C:\ bamboo_agent \ xml-data \ build-dir \ UFO-UFAUT-JOB1 \ Auth \ RGS.UFO.Auth.Tests \ _bin \ Debug \ RGS.UFO.Auth.Tests。 dll /result=%CD%\NUnitResults.xml;format=nunit2“

SonarQube.Scanner.MSBuild.exe结束